Superior-Order Curvature-Correction Techniques for Voltage References

Beschreibung
Superior-Order Curvature-Correction Techniques for Voltage References is dedicated to the analysis and design of voltage reference circuits and evaluates improving their temperature behavior by implementing superior-order curvature-correction techniques. The author begins with the study of biasing current references with controllable temperature dependencies. That is followed by examining simple zero-order and first-order curvature-corrected voltage reference circuits which leads into the final topic of the analysis of superior-order curvature-correction techniques. The book is dedicated to the analysis and design of voltage reference circuits, the intended audience being high-level students and specialists in the area of analog and mixed-signal CMOS VLSI design. The aim of the book is to evaluate the possibilities of improving the thermal behavior of voltage references by implementing superior-order curvature-correction techniques.
